Odaily Planet Daily News According to official news, Bahamut recently launched its L2 network Caucasus to improve scalability and serve as a game-oriented blockchain. The main goal of Caucasus is to provide higher transaction speed, scalability, and cost efficiency by sharing the burden with the Bahamut mainnet. It will reduce transaction fees (gas fees) and speed up transaction times during high network activity by speeding up transaction delays by 6 times, increasing throughput by 12 times, and providing a 2-second time frame for block creation instead of the 12-second range in L1. As L2 on top of the Bahamut mainnet, Caucasus will host more decentralized games and other protocols, helping to strengthen the network and gain additional incentives for operating nodes.
